今天公司一客户要求一同事给ckeditor加入可以设置行高的功能(他后台是用织梦做的,他是织梦的FANS),我一时闲得慌,也想给咱家的v9加入这个功能,功夫不负有心啊,终于成功了,来给大家分享一下!

首先下载lineheight插件,我已经上传附件给大家了

第二步:在v9的与phpcms同级的目录找到statics/js/ckeditor/plugins这个目录:再把lineheight插件解压到这个目录!

第三步:找到statics/js/ckeditor/config.js修改如下:

CKEDITOR.editorConfig = function( config ){

                              ……………………

                              config.extraPlugins += (config.extraPlugins ? ',lineheight' : 'lineheight');//在这个方法中加入这个一句,前面的不要动;
}

第四步:在phpcms\libs\classes目录中找到form.class.php修改如下

在 ['Styles','Format','Font','FontSize'] 后面 再加上lineheight

                      ['Styles','Format','Font','FontSize','lineheight']

就这样OK了,在进后台刷新,在工具栏就出来了行高的功能了!

最后一步,附上文件:https://files.cnblogs.com/files/yuan9580/phpcms%E5%90%8E%E5%8F%B0ckeditor%E5%8A%A0%E5%85%A5%E7%BB%99%E5%86%85%E5%AE%B9%E8%B0%83%E6%95%B4%E8%A1%8C%E9%AB%98.zip

最新文章

  1. ios 控件代码transform学习笔记
  2. Linux下监控服务器状态命令——top
  3. [原创]html5游戏_贪吃蛇
  4. for 循环中 i++和 ++i
  5. ReplicaManager之DelayedOperation
  6. iOS 支付宝应用(备用参考)
  7. Msys下gcc的配置
  8. HW4.40
  9. 如何使用TcpDump抓取远程主机的流量并回显到本地的WireShark上
  10. 一个Java对象到底占多大内存
  11. CentOS6.6普通用户使用sudo命令借用root用户权限
  12. perl 第十四章 Perl5的包和模块
  13. c# windows服务 一个项目安装多个服务
  14. 表格和echart二级联动,并通过点击echart高亮图标单元格
  15. 微信小程序-遍历列表
  16. matlab-非线性拟合函数lsqcurvefit的使用和初值选取
  17. 由pushViewController说起可能出线的各种死法
  18. Redis 实现队列http://igeekbar.com/igeekbar/post/436.htm
  19. 2018-2019-2 网络对抗技术 20165202 Exp5 MSF基础应用
  20. 在 html中怎么获取中的参数

热门文章

  1. ubuntu 12.04 64位 安装wps
  2. 学习python第四天——Oracle查询
  3. MySQL——总结
  4. CUDA和OpenGL互操作经典博文赏析和学习
  5. for var let闭包理解
  6. 基于VUE.JS的移动端框架Mint UI
  7. (转)LR性能测试结果样例分析
  8. POJ 3468 A Simple Problem with Integers(线段树模板之区间增减更新 区间求和查询)
  9. CANopen和DeviceNet有何异同
  10. Centos7 yum安装Mysql5.7